Peterborough Chase to be re-staged at Taunton this Thursday, 14 December 2017

11 Dec 2017 糖心传媒 Features Racing/Fixtures

糖心传媒 (糖心传媒) has today announced that the Peterborough Chase, originally due to be run at Huntingdon yesterday, has been re-scheduled to take place at Taunton’s fixture this Thursday, 14 December.

The race will be run for 拢50,000 over a distance of 2 miles 5 1/2 furlongs,聽 and has been re-staged with the help of the 糖心传媒 Development Fund, Horseracing Betting Levy Board (HBLB)聽 and Taunton Racecourse. New entries close tomorrow, Tuesday 12 December at 12 noon. The race will declare at the 24 hour stage as normal on Wednesday 13 December.

The going at Taunton is currently good to soft, good in places. Full details and race conditions can be found on the racing admin site

Stuart Middleton, Racing Operations Manager at the 糖心传媒, said:

“The Peterborough Chase is an historic and important race, and we are pleased to be able to reschedule it.

“Our thanks go to the HBLB聽 and Taunton for stepping up to stage the race at short notice, and we hope that racegoers, participants and punters all enjoy a fine renewal of a valuable contest.鈥
